Abstract
Fiber Bragg Grating (FBG) strain-sensing system has been paid much attention for the advantages of its light weight, anti-explosion, and harmlessness for electromagnetic noise, but it has not been widely used in practical applications with the high price. We have developed a new concept of wavelength meter in which the transmission center wavelength is monitored by mechanically applying a certain strain to a scanning FBG. The accuracy and stability are found to be ±0.01 nm for 12 days running, which is enough for the most applications.
